The Amundsen School-Based Health Center is a partnership between Advocate Illinois Masonic Medical Center and Amundsen High School. The goal of the Health Center is to improve the physical and emotional health of Amundsen students and teach them life-long positive health behaviors. Students must have a signed parental/guardian consent form on file before they can receive services at the Health Center.
During the 2005-2006 school year, Amundsen Health Center provided over 2000 individual office visits and had over 2600 student contacts through group visits. More than 90% of students who attended Amundsen had a signed parental consent form on file.
Health Center staff are employees of Advocate Illinois Masonic Medical Center. Providers include Family Physicians, Nurse Practitioners, Clinical Psychologists, Health Educators, and a Medical Assistant. The Health Center is open Monday through Friday during school hours.
The staff of the Health Center consider parental involvement important. Every student is encouraged to involve their parent(s)/guardian(s) in health care decisions.
